There were several other Abbots with Corpse Transformation cultivations. These fellows were rather docile and made no move, merely guarding a side hall for Buddha worship.

Since it was on his way, Yang An, in his capacity as the Buddha’s Son, felt obliged to pay his respects and wanted to enter for worship. But... he was refused by those fellows.

Although their words weren’t impolite, Yang An knew they were surely cursing him in their hearts.

’Since they were cursing me, it was a provocation. I had no choice but to act.’

And so, along the way, the Xian Shrine in Yang An’s possession had absorbed no fewer than a hundred Demon Barriers. He took the opportunity to undo his Concealment Seal, revealing his Cultivation Level to be at the Middle Stage of Corpse Transformation.

And his true Cultivation Level, having absorbed the Demon Barriers of several deceased individuals who also had Corpse Transformation cultivations, was now not too far from the Zombie God realm.

It was now just past 1:00 AM. The last time he walked from the Mingxin Zen Courtyard to Grand View Cave Zen, it had taken him less than half an hour. Tonight, however, adopting a leisurely pace, he had walked for a full hour and a half and still hadn’t reached his destination.

He could only blame the scenery within the temple—sights he’d never appreciated before—for being so utterly captivating tonight, making him want to linger.

Soon, he continued walking in the direction of Grand View Cave Zen.

He had only taken a few steps when several protectors suddenly darted out from a side street, looking as if they were fleeing in a panic. 𝚏𝗿𝗲𝐞𝐰𝚎𝕓𝐧𝚘𝘃𝗲𝐥.𝐜𝚘𝕞

THWACK!

A flying pebble struck Yang An’s arm with some force.

Yang An’s previously serene expression instantly twisted with rage.

’This time, it wasn’t my fault. These guys had actually gone and provoked me.’

"You..."

With a dark expression, Yang An opened his mouth to ask these fellows why they were provoking him. But he only managed to get out one word before he saw a black shadow suddenly pass right through the group of protectors.

In the blink of an eye, copious amounts of blood sprayed from the protectors, and their bodies were instantly mangled.

Half of the flesh on their bodies had inexplicably vanished, as if something had taken a huge bite, ripping it away and swallowing it.

The men all groaned in pain, attempting to recover by drawing on their Immortality.

But in the next instant, hundreds of palm prints appeared on their bodies. Each strike caved in their flesh, squeezing out copious amounts of yellow and white matter from within.

The scene was suddenly both bloody and bizarre.

The protectors were nearly powerless to resist. On the verge of a violent death, their eyes filled with terror.

Just then, countless white feathers suddenly appeared in mid-air, with fleeting flashes of crimson flickering among them. They materialized in front of the protectors, blocking the path between them and the shadowy figure.

On the brink of death, the protectors saw someone intervene in their moment of crisis and began to weep with joy.

’This is... Someone is trying to save us!’

A glance revealed that it was none other than the temple’s new His Highness the Buddha Prince!

In their eyes, the figure instantly became like a savior, suffused with holy Buddha’s Radiance.

"Buddha’s Son, save us..."

Enduring their agony, the men joyfully began to speak.

But before they could finish speaking, the White Feathers, glinting with a cold light, descended upon them like rain. In an instant, the men were diced to pieces, their flesh and blood turning to ash as they were torn apart.

One after another, their Buddhist Shrines shattered like a string of firecrackers. Streams of Demon Barriers flew out from them, ultimately flowing into the Xian Shrine in front of Yang An.

As another small portion of pure Mana flowed into his body, Yang An reached out and rubbed his arm. That pebble from before had really stung.

’It was still hurting, but it wasn’t my arm that ached—it was my heart! Someone had almost poached my kill.’

He glanced at the figure still standing there and raised an eyebrow. ’This fellow’s cultivation aura is only at the Visceral Stone stage, yet he was chasing down several other protectors of the same level. His combat prowess is clearly impressive.’

When he saw the person’s face, he couldn’t help but mutter to himself, ’So ugly.’

From a distance, the person’s entire body appeared covered in black hair, even on his head and hands. Only upon closer inspection could one see that the so-called hair was actually countless, densely packed, microscopic Buddhist Mantras.

’Who would cover their own body in Buddhist Mantras? Anyone who does that is definitely not normal.’

Yang An studied him, but the fellow had no facial features. Even so, Yang An could feel an invisible gaze land on him.

However, the gaze only swept over him for a moment before vanishing. The ugly protector then turned to leave.

Facing Yang An, he began to slowly back away, preparing to retreat into the alley behind him.

’I don’t plan on bothering with him. He’s just a minor protector. I’ll let him go.’

But just then, as if by chance, a sudden gust of wind blew from the ugly protector’s direction toward Yang An, carrying the recently formed ash with it.

A single, tiny speck of ash landed perfectly on the back of Yang An’s hand.

Yang An’s expression changed in an instant!

’Fine, just fine. I was going to let you go, but you dare to provoke me!’

The countless White Feathers, which he had not yet recalled, instantly shot toward the protector like high-speed bullets.

RUMBLE!

The courtyard walls surrounding the protector were instantly demolished, and the two Golden Buddha Statues standing at the intersection were pulverized.

The man clearly hadn’t expected Yang An to attack so suddenly, but his reflexes were incredibly fast. In an instant, he looked up and struck out with his palm.
